The Italy-based company was made in 2010 to be a passion project by a gang of hackers so, who prioritize level of privacy and net neutrality. They’ve seeing that grown right into a service which has a generous server network, versatile apps and unique accessories like an advanced DNS course-plotting system that may bypass geo-restrictions.
AirVPN’s secureness features include industry-standard 256-bit AES encryption and a tight no-logs policy, as well as an advanced destroy switch and split tunneling. There are also a couple of interesting accessories, such as support for Durchgang and complete leak security (I couldn’t find any kind of IP, DNS or WebRTC leaks).

AirVPN has a good number of platform compatibilities, and you can use the same app about desktop computers, mobile devices, popular routers and even gaming systems and smart TVs. The program is available to get a wide variety of Linux distributions, with 64-bit and 32-bit GUI apps with respect to Debian, Ubuntu, Fedora and Arch; and portable Mono and command-line versions for every them along with Raspberry Pi.
